Grendel Grendel Grendel
«Dan and Lienors Torre continue their invaluable contribution to the histories of Australian (and international) animation with this fascinating study of Alexander Stitt’s utterly unique cult classic Grendel Grendel Grendel (1981), its production and circulation, and its themes and resonances as a ‘reanimation’ of Beowulf’s monster.»
Stephen Morgan, Screening Coordinator, Menzies Australia Institute, King's College London, UK
